The unification of Italy: everything you wanted to know
from HistoryExtra podcast · host Immediate
In 1861, the kingdom of Italy was proclaimed, unifying the various Italian states under one national banner. But what did it mean to be 'Italian' in the mid-19th century? How did the pope react to the concept of a united Italy? And why did so many British women fall in love with Garibaldi? In conversation with Spencer Mizen, historian David Laven answers listener questions on the campaign to unify Italy: the Risorgimento.
